WebThe plot of The Great Train Robbery was actually inspired from a real event. On August 29, 1900, four members from the famous outlaw George Leroy “Butch Cassidy” Parker’s “Hole in the Wall” gang stopped a train in Table Rock, Wyoming and stole $5,000. Web6 mei 2024 · The Great Train Robbery comprised 14 separate shots of noncontinuous, nonoverlapping action and was a major departure from the frontally composed, theatrical staging used by Méliès and most other filmmakers.
